Rechargeable electrochemical cell with a negative electrode comprising a hydrogen absorbing alloy including rare earth component

A rechargeable electrochemical cell a positive electrode, an alkaline electrolyte and a negative electrode made mainly of a hydrogen absorbing alloy containing a mixture of at least two rare earth elements including Ce whose content relative to the total amount of rare earth elements is less than 40 wt % and is preferably 0.1 wt % to 12 wt % or in the range 0.1-8 wt %, which gives still better capacity and life characteristics. Moreover, larger capacity characteristics can be obtained if the negative electrode contains a conductive powder preferably with an average particle diameter of 10 .mu.m or less as a subsidiary material. |
|
DETAILED DESCRIPTION The object of the present invention is to provide a long-life rechargeable electrochemical cell with a negative electrode comprising a hydrogen absorbing alloy which can be manufactured at low cost and whose electrochemical capacity does not decrease even after a number of charging and discharging cycles. According to the invention, this object is achieved by means of a rechargeable electrochemical cell comprising a positive electrode, an alkaline electrolyte, a separator and a negative electrode constituted mainly by the hydrogen absorbing alloy containing a mixture of at least two rare earth elements including Ce as a rare earth component in which the Ce content is less than 40 wt % relative to the total amount of rare earth elements. It is particularly suitable to use a mixture of rare earth elements prepared from ordinary mischmetal from which Ce has been partially removed to make the Ce content less than 40 wt % relative to the total amount of the rare earth elements as the rare earth component of a hydrogen absorbing alloy, since it permits easy manufacture at low cost. The Ce content in this case is preferably 0. 1-12 wt % relative to the total amount of the rare earth elements, since making it this value improves the cell characteristics. The optimum range is 0. 1-8 wt %. The rare earth component of the hydrogen absorbing alloy constituting the material of the negative electrode in the cell according to the invention can be easily manufactured by, for example, effecting removal of a certain amount (partial removal) of Ce from the raw materials during the process of produce of commercial mischmetal (containing 40-50 wt % of Ce). In more detail, on roasting of naturally produced, refined bastnaesite or monazite, etc. , only Ce can become a quadrivalent oxide, while the other rare earth elements become trivalent oxides, and so hydrochloric acid extraction of the oxides results in precipitation only of Ce, which can easily be separated by filtering.
